The error indicates that the PIPES
environment variable is an invalid JSON string. It should be of the format
"PIPES": {
"Whatsapp Chat": "telegram channel id"
}
SyntaxError: Unexpected token u in JSON at position 0
Specifically there is a "u" at the first position of this string
Verify that your PIPES
variable is a proper JSON string

First of all the token is sensitive, don't post it publicly. I've removed it.
Are you using settings.json
or environment variables. It seems to me you're using settings.json
file
If you're using settings.json
, it's not being detected, that's why the program tries to read variables from the environment. Your file's name has to be settings.json
and it has to be included in your docker image for this to work.
The JSON looks good to me, verify that you're naming your conf file settings.json
, its in the same directory as index.js, and it's included in the docker image.
